The Sakura 15261 12-Piece Koi Assorted Water Color Tube Set is a premium collection designed for professionals, fine artists, and students. Each set includes 12 x 12-milliliter tubes of vibrant, transparent watercolors that can be applied to both wet and dry paper. With a focus on quality and versatility, these watercolors conform to ASTM D4236 standards, making them a reliable choice for any artist looking to elevate their craft.

I keep buying these, but why?
Koi watercolors are raved over by many art journal makers and urban sketchers, and they are pretty good for this use, however I wouldn't recommend them for actual watercolor painting. The pan forms are actually dry cakes, not semi-moist pans, contain a lot of filler, and therefore tend to look chalky when dried. The tube form is nicer, but they don't re-wet well when allowed to dry and subsequently used as pans. They are cheap, and colorful and yes, I would recommend them for sketching and art journaling/mixed media work, but for true watercolor painting you can't get a better brand than Van Gogh...these beautiful student watercolors are almost impossible to distinguish from artists quality most of the time. The only reason I keep buying them is that they are more readily available in places like Michaels and Hobby Lobby, and with the 40% off coupon make a good beginners purchase for students. I purchased this tube set because I wanted to pour them into cheap palettes and make up some pan sets for my students and grandchild to use, however, I ended up buying some more Van Gogh a week later because I was so disappointed with the Koi.
